Output 68d9238f12b8a3117376253c1d7cbb6130dd58b52586ef15aedecaaf19bdfc02:0

value
64916
script pubkey
OP_0 OP_PUSHBYTES_20 38c0c0e8b0e21d96d55b39ad8688bf566aa81456
address
tb1q8rqvp69sugwed42m8xkcdz9l2e42s9zk9k29xa
transaction
68d9238f12b8a3117376253c1d7cbb6130dd58b52586ef15aedecaaf19bdfc02
confirmations
81809
spent
true